TeamCity CI CD Server

TeamCity CI CD Server

www.jetbrains.com

2

About this website

TeamCity is a powerful continuous integration and continuous deployment server developed by JetBrains (founded in 2000 by Sergey Dmitriev, based in Prague and Amsterdam). With over 30,000 organizations including Samsung, Volkswagen, and HP, TeamCity provides enterprise-grade build automation and pipeline orchestration. Key features: build pipeline (define complex multi-stage build chains with dependencies, artifact passing, and parallel execution using visual pipeline editor or Kotlin DSL). Build agents (distributed build execution across multiple agents running on Windows, Linux, and macOS, with agent pools for resource isolation and cloud agents for elastic scaling on AWS, Azure, and GCP). VCS integration (native integration with Git, Subversion, Perforce, Mercurial, Team Foundation Server, and Bitbucket with branch-based builds and pull request building). Build triggers (VCS triggers, schedule triggers, dependency triggers, retry triggers, and user-initiated builds with quiet period for batching changes). Build features (test reporting with automatic failure detection, code coverage integration with JaCoCo, dotCover, and Istanbul, code inspection with InspectCode, duplicate finder, and build progress charts). Artifact management (publish, share, and store build artifacts with artifact dependencies between build configurations and external artifact storage). Key features include role-based access control with project hierarchy permissions, LDAP and SAML SSO integration, audit logging, and per-project user management. Integrations with JIRA, YouTrack, Bugzilla, and GitHub Issues for issue tracking. REST API for programmatic access to builds, projects, and configuration management. DSL-based configuration (Kotlin DSL for version-controlled build configuration enabling code review of pipeline changes).

Statistics

2
Views
0
Clicks
0
Like
0
Dislike

Comments

Log In to post a comment

No comments yet. Be the first!